Job Description: Lead DevOps Engineer, M&S Platform Baseline
Location: Hanscom AFB, MA
Clearance: Secret
Overview:
We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Lead DevOps Engineer to manage and enhance the Modeling and Simulation (M&S) Platform Baseline for the Command-and-Control Systems Engineering Technology (C2SET) program. This role involves developing and maintaining complex systems, leveraging DevSecOps tools and processes, and ensuring the platform’s reliability and availability.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in platform development, cloud services, and infrastructure management.
This position is contingent upon contract award.
Key Responsibilities:
Systems Development:
  • Relevant experience in developing systems using C++, Python, AFSIM, Web services, Database, and/or web application development.
DevSecOps Proficiency:
  • Demonstrate proficiency with DevSecOps tools and processes, including but not limited to GitLab, SonarQube, and Fortify, to ensure secure and efficient development and deployment pipelines.
Platform Architecture and Implementation:
  • Architect, implement, and configure the M&S DevSecOps Platform for both cloud and on-premises environments, taking into account the specific requirements of M&S applications, users, and sites.
Infrastructure as Code:
  • Develop and manage core platform services, implementing Infrastructure as Code practices for consistent and repeatable infrastructure provisioning and management.
System Reliability and Availability:
  • Design and maintain systems to achieve high reliability and availability, ensuring that platform services are robust, dependable, and perform well under various conditions.
Transition Engineering Support:
  • Provide support for transition engineering efforts, ensuring smooth and efficient transitions of systems and services, including legacy to modernized platform migrations.
Qualifications:
  • A minimum of 7 years of relevant experience in systems development using languages and technologies such as C++, Python, AFSIM, Web services, Database, and web application development.
  • Proven experience and proficiency with DevSecOps tools and processes, including GitLab, SonarQube, and Fortify.
  • Experience in platform development including core platform services and implementing Infrastructure as Code.
  • Demonstrated experience in designing and maintaining highly reliable and available systems.
  • Secret Security Clearance required
Skills and Competencies:
  • Strong technical expertise in DevSecOps tools and processes.
  • Ability to architect, implement, and manage complex platform solutions for both cloud and on-premises environments.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and a detail-oriented approach to system design and maintenance.
  • Effective communication and collaboration skills to work with diverse teams and stakeholders in a high-paced environment.
